"The issue of the Orang Asli's assimilation, however, is not merely a concern of the ruling government. The opposition Islamic party PAS concurs with the view that Islamisation should be a strategy for lifting the Orang Malays. The PAS Member of Parliament for Kubang Kerian, Mohamed Sabu, even suggested that, "instead of being recognised as Orang Asli, they should be assimilated into the Malay race. Their culture should be integrated so that they will no longer be considered separated from Malays." (The Star 26.11.1997)"

"Clearly the apparent intention of the Aboriginal Peoples Act seems to be the refusal to recognise the Orang Asli as the autonomous social unit that they were in the past. In fact, as has been the case in several instances, this legal instrument has been effectively used to deny Orang Asli control and ownership over their traditional territories."

"However, the Orang Asli involved were not happy with this move. Juki Sungkai, an Orang Asli youth leader, had questioned why forest products valued at RM60 million (USD15.8 million) were to be apportioned by the Koperasi Daya Asli Johor Berhad (mainly set up by JHEOA officers) and not by the local community. For this reason alone, Juki Added, "The regroupment project in Bekok should be put on hold because the project was given to a company which is not in accordance with the Orang Asli Act" (Utusan Malaysia 10.6.1997)."

"This is not to suggest that early Orang Asli societies developed in isolation. On the contrary, far from remaining static, they have had to continually change and adapt themselves and their social organisation to their environment, their neighbours, and to new centres of power. However, the Emergency, and the consequent attention paid to them by the government through the agency if the JHEOA, were to further exposed Orang Asli groups to one another. Some have attributed this increased awareness (of other Orang Asli groups) to the mixing at the Orang Asli hospital in Gombak, at the annual JHEOA social events, or in district or state-level official events organised for the Orang Asli."

"In a further move to encourage Orang Asli to join UMNO - and so help the party achieve its 600,000 membership - UMNO Secretary-General, Mohamed Rahmat, remarked that the Orang Asli, "should be given the chance to be actively involved in the country's politics...They also had the right to decide on the position of the country's leadership" (The Star 21.2.1989). Clearly, then, the eal motive for opening the party's doors to the Orang Asl was to help secure the position of the "country's leadership"."

"In August, at a special function for the Orang Asli community in Kelantan, Tengku Razaleigh, now the state UMNO liaison committee chairman, told the Orang Asli that their living condition and livelihood would be better under a Barisan Nasional state government which would also take measures to overcome problems concerning the Orang Asli community including matters pertaining to the gazatting of the Orang Asli reserves (New Straits Times 4.8.1999). At the same function, Tengku Razaleigh, in his call to the Orang Asli to thelp the Barisan Nasional win in the coming general election, also claimed tha several areas of Orang Asli reserve land had been enroached upon by some quarters, including state goverment agencies, for logging and other activities."

"Hence, it is not uncommon to have two headmen in a particular settlement: one hereditary or elected by the community, the other appointed by the JHEOA. The tendency is for the JHEOA to appoint someone who is at least a little literate in Mlay, and preferably someone who is amenable to its dictates. This usually implies a younger person, and therefore usually someone less experiences in the traditions and customs of thee community."

"Also, one of the first policy statements made during his acceptance speech was that POASM would encourage Malays to become members. The suggestion provoked much debate, but no vote was taken on the matter. Subsequently, in February 1992, it was learned that the JHEOA Director-General became a member and was reportedly appointed an Advisor. Several Malays, mainly those working with the JHEOA, were also said to have applied to become members."
